  2. Begin by reviewing the 'Objective' section. Ensure you understand the procedures outlined for minimizing heat illness hazards.
  3. Move to the 'Responsibilities' section. Fill in details regarding supervisors and foremen responsible for implementing the plan in your work area.
  4. In the 'Employee Training' section, confirm that all employees have received necessary training before working in hot conditions. Document any training sessions conducted.
  5. Complete the 'Water Procedures' section by detailing how potable drinking water will be provided, including locations and quantities required per employee.
  6. Fill out the 'Shade Procedures' section, ensuring that shade availability is clearly defined based on temperature thresholds.
  7. Review and complete sections on 'Emergency Response', 'Observation and Acclimatization', and ensure all employees are aware of their roles and responsibilities.

For indoor workplaces where the temperature docHubes 82 degrees Fahrenheit, employers must take steps to protect workers from heat illness. Some of the requirements include providing water, rest, cool-down areas, methods for cooling down the work areas under certain conditions, and training.
Employers with an indoor workspace that docHubes 82F or higher when workers are present must implement a written Indoor Heat Illness Prevention Plan that includes procedures for: The provision of water. Access to cool-down areas.
The 2022 Action Plan outlines Californias all-of-government approach to mitigating the health, economic, cultural, ecological, and social impacts of increasing average temperatures and heat waves. It constitutes Californias response to what has become known as extreme heat and accompanying extreme heat events.
